WHAT IS LOL META? THE DEFINITION

As previously said, lol meta is a popular term among LoL players and usually refers to the metagaming. Metagaming is much wider term thus it relates to many other. Let’s just quote the wikipedia

Metagaming is any strategy, action or method used in a game which transcends a prescribed ruleset, uses external factors to affect the game, or goes beyond the supposed limits or environment set by the game. Another definition refers to the game universe outside of the game itself. Metagaming differs from strategy in that metagaming is making decisions based upon out of game knowledge, whereas strategies are decisions made based upon in-game actions and knowledge.

As you can see a lot of things fit the definition of metagaming. When it comes to LoL then definition of lol meta will be:

LOL META CHAMPIONS AND PICKS

Usually, about only 20-30 champions are getting the most love when it comes to the champion pick. Moreover, the difference in the pick rate between the first and last one is really huge. For example, on 30/11/2017 (we use lolking.net champion dataVayne pick rate is equals to 7% while Skaner is being picked only with 0.2% rate. Meanwhile Skarner has bigger win rate: 49,7% vs 50,2%. And such situation occur regularly, thus at any time you can find top meta pick in LoL with lower win rate than one of least popular champions has.

There are few major factors that affect popularity of lol meta champions in league. 

  • Major tournaments almost always shift LoL meta to the certain champion picks. Players looking for new ways of play executed by pro players and want to follow it in their games. Usually, it’s enough to start of certain champion pick rate to start snowballing and that champion becomes popular among all playerbase and not only among players who watch tournaments. Tournaments are main cause of formation of the new meta in LoL, especially when it comes to lol meta champions.
  • The same situation happens when popular streamers starting to play effectively an unpopular champion with non-standart builds. This can shift meta and make that champion and build become a standart in LoL.
  • Champion considered to be imbalanced by community. Often, it leads to the high popularity of champions which demands high-skill and such popularity cuts off the win rate of champion. Good examples here are Yasuo and Zed.

META IS NOT ALWAYS RIGHT! PICK AND BANS OF ZIGGS, ZED AND YASUO 

We decided to consider these three champions separately because they showing one of the important facts – there is no guarantee of getting higher chances to win when you follow lol meta. Zed and Yasuo are in the very top among most banned and most picked champions. However, their win rates are incredibly low and are negative for very long time. Right now, Zed has 49.4% win rate and Yasuo has only 47.9% win rate! That happens because both of these champions demand high skill and great mechanics. But because they are being incredible popular people consider them as OP champions and pick them in hope that champion itself will carry the game.

There is opposite situation with some unpopular champions in the current meta. Lets discuss one of them, it’s Ziggs. When he was released, over a year he was on the very bottom of pickrate and haven’t got any buffs. Then Ziggs appeared on the LCS league and become incredible popular for a while and got several significant nerfs. Right now, Ziggs is not popular champion with 0.9% pickrate, but has incredible 53.2% win rate!

If you sort champion statistics by win rate you will that half of champions in the top aren’t part of meta picks (their pickrate is less than 2%). This means that there are many underrated champions which are actually stronger than most people think and can be the actual carry champions

Just because champion is hyped among the community that doesn’t mean that he would brings positive outcome in your games. Moreover, very often it affects negatively your chances to win.

META LANE POSITION: WHY THERE IS NO PLACE IN META FOR DUO TOP

Even default distribution by lanes in LoL (solo top lane, ADc and support on the bottom lane, solo mid lane and jungler) wasn’t always so obvious. In the very beginning you could easily see a two tank champion on the bottom lane before it became hard meta to follow the significant roles. You could even see the same kind of duo on the top lane. This leads us to the question: “Why there are always two champions on the bottom but no on the top lane?” The answer is simple because of ability to control dragon and early team fights on the river around dragon spawn. Some period of time duo top was a meta on the NA LCS. Pro teams were swapping lanes to get the top turret as fast as possible with champions like Caitlyn and Lulu and were swapping back to defend their turret on the bottom. This strategy was nerfed by developers and now during the early game turrets are getting reduced damage from the champions. Therefore there is no place left for duo top in the current.

SERVER META IN LoL

Meta can be different in each region. That’s why picks and strategies on different servers may vary significantly. However, meta can transfer itself from a server to server. There is a story that proves it. For the first months after his release, Lucian was absolutely not popular and he wasn’t seem to be picked in the ranked games. Almost no one was playing him until korean teams started to pick him on proleagues. After that, he became incredibly popular (initially at the korean server and then in the rest regions). Since that time, Lucian survived several solid nerfs and his popularity went back to the abyss.

WHY PEOPLE FOLLOW META IN LoL

Most players follow lol meta and there are several psychological reasons for that, let’s list them:

  • Most people feel much more comfortable when they are part of the majority. Thus it’s much easier for us to copy the dominant trends they see. Also sometimes people fear that they will be condemned if they do not follow the general course.
  • We tend to believe the authorities. When pro team shows new picks on popular league, these picks are at the same time becoming popular among ordinary players.
  • It was proved that most people can only keep in mind 7±2 objects in their mind simultaneously. This leads to a very limited pool of popular champions for each role among majority of LoL players.  
  • We prefer order over chaos, and meta in any game provides us with the order.

However, we don’t say that following meta is bad. Often, meta shows a way of playing which is close to optimal (and certainly much closer to optimal way than random choices).
